Things To Check
When you got hold of the mobile phone you are going to buy, there are several things to check before you decide to buy it.
– Test the sound quality. Test its ring tones, its music player, its sound recording.
– Test the display. Test its wallpaper, its screen saver, and its games. If there are any ‘heavy’ games available, like 3D racing games, check that they run smoothly.
– Test the memory. Test the internal memory and try saving data using external memory.
– Test the camera and video recording.
– Check the package accessories. Make sure they are all there and check that they’re all functioning.
– Ask for the After Sales Service.
Take Into Counts How The Phone “Behave” And You Own Behavior
Everybody has their own ways of using handphones. Some people prefer simplicity and some others prefer enhancements. Observe how your own habit on using cellphones. Do you always take along your phone in your hand or pockets, or do you often leave out your phone back on your desk? Do you install 3rd party applications a lot into your mobile device or do you rarely use the phone other than to talk and to text? If you always take along your phone in your hand, consider buying small or mini-size handphones and handphones that do not need many accessories attached.
